Comedian Roseanne Barr receives People's Choice Awards
Comedian Roseanne Barr, a double winner at Sunday Might's 16th Annual People's Choice Awards on march 11, 1990 is all smiles. Barr was named favorite female TV performer and favorite all around female entertainer. (UPI Photo/Jim Ruymen/Files)
